What Is a Mountain Flight in Nepal?
A mountain flight—also known as an Everest scenic flight—is a short aerial tour that departs from Kathmandu early in the morning. The flight follows the Himalayan range, providing panoramic views of snow-capped mountains.
- Duration: 45–60 minutes
- Departure: Tribhuvan International Airport, Kathmandu
- Seat: Guaranteed window seat for every passenger
Mountains You Can See
During the mountain flight, passengers can witness:
- Mount Everest (8,848.86 m)
- Lhotse
- Nuptse
- Makalu
- Kanchenjunga
- Cho Oyu
Each mountain is clearly pointed out by the flight crew, making the experience informative and memorable.
Best Time for Mountain Flight in Nepal
The best time for an Everest mountain flight is when skies are clear and visibility is high:
- Spring (March–May)
- Autumn (September–November)
Flights operate early in the morning (6:00–9:00 AM) for the clearest Himalayan views.
Mountain Flight Cost in Nepal
The cost of a mountain flight in Nepal typically ranges between USD 200–250 per person, depending on the airline and season. Prices usually include:
- Airport transfers
- Flight certificate
- Guaranteed window seat
